This photographic duet of Josep Compte Agrimon (Barcelona, 1910-1987) and Palatchi were, along with artists of the stature of Pere Català Pic and Josep Sala, two of the most important advertising photographers in the thirties. During that decade they made numerous photomontages for companies such as Formitrol and Lápiz Termosán, in which they combined photography and advertising using the typographic advances of the time. In these pioneering works of advertising-photo-reportage, made in a surrealist and chiaroscuro style, the advertised product floats over an infinite darkness. In other work, they also took numerous photographs of stage sets and performances of the Russian ballets at the Gran Teatre del Liceu, Barcelona, captured in an intoxicating dramatic style.
